Job Responsibilities Project Manager I: Clinical Business Strategy & Operations (Sponsor Dedicated /Remote: US Based) Become the Operational Powerhouse Behind High‑Impact Clinical Initiatives Are you a master organizer, a communications ace, and the steady hand that keeps complex operations running flawlessly? Do you thrive in fast‑paced environments where details matter, leaders rely on you, and no two days look the same? If so, our Business Strategy & Operations (BS&O) team within Clinical Trial Capabilities wants you. We’re seeking a Project Manager I—a dynamic, detail‑obsessed operational strategist who loves structure, communication, and bringing clarity to chaos. This is a sponsor‑dedicated, high‑visibility role supporting senior leaders and mission‑critical initiatives. WHAT YOU'LL DO: As the go‑to coordination and communications engine for the BS&O team, you will: Drive Clear, Impactful Communication: • Draft crisp, compelling internal communications, updates, and announcements • Build and refine templates, newsletters, intranet content, and collaboration posts • Maintain SharePoint and internal communication sites to ensure the organization stays aligned Keep Projects and Operations Running Like Clockwork: • Coordinate non‑portfolio projects—tracking timelines, deliverables, and action items • Support resource alignment and data tracking across tools like Smartsheet and internal systems • Manage reports, dashboards, shared repositories, and operational documentation Own Meetings & Leader Support: • Prepare agendas, take high‑quality minutes, and keep stakeholders accountable • Partner with high‑level leaders as a “chief of staff–like” operator • Support large‑scale events, all‑hands meetings, and virtual sessions Be the Administrative Backbone: • Handle systems requests, follow-ups, and day‑to‑day operational needs • Problem-solve across teams to remove roadblocks and keep workflows moving This role blends project coordination, communications excellence, administrative rigor, and operational leadership—perfect for someone who loves variety and multitasking. WHAT YOU BRING: Required • 4+ years in project coordination, communications, change management, or similar roles • Exceptional written and verbal communication skills • Superb organization, multitasking ability, and a sharp eye for detail • Experience preparing, running, and documenting meetings • Comfort working in fast-paced, high-pressure environments • Proficiency in Microsoft Office and SharePoint Preferred • Background in communications or public affairs • Experience with Smartsheet or similar project management tools • Experience in pharmaceuticals or biotech WHO THRIVES HERE: This role is perfect if you are: ✔️ Energized by supporting senior leaders and cross‑functional teams ✔️ A natural organizer with a passion for precision ✔️ A clear, confident communicator ✔️ Able to juggle multiple priorities without missing a beat ✔️ Someone who takes pride in being the “glue” that holds complex operations together If you’re ready to step into a sponsor‑facing role where your structure, communication finesse, and operational strengths truly shine—we’d love to meet you. The benefits for this position may include a company car or car allowance, Health benefits to include Medical, Dental and Vision, Company match 401k, eligibility to participate in Employee Stock Purchase Plan, Eligibility to earn commissions/bonus based on company and individual performance, and flexible paid time off (PTO) and sick time. Because certain states and municipalities have regulated paid sick time requirements, eligibility for paid sick time may vary depending on where you work. Syneos complies with all applicable federal, state, and municipal paid sick time requirements. Salary Range: $80,600.00 - $145,000.00 The base salary range represents the anticipated low and high of the Syneos Health range for this position. Actual salary will vary based on various factors such as the candidate’s qualifications, skills, competencies, and proficiency for the role.
